11a Mandalay Road

    11A, MANDALAY ROAD, LONDON, LONDON, SW4 9ED

    This flat/maisonette leasehold property on Mandalay Road last sold in April 2006 for £397,500. Based on price growth in the SW4 district since then, its estimated current value is £804,196 — placing it in the 93rd percentile nationally and the 70th percentile within SW4. The property covers 76 m² (818 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£10,582 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of C.

    District Context — SW4

    SW4 covers Clapham and the surrounding neighbourhoods in south London, positioned between Balham and Battersea. It is an affluent residential district with strong appeal to young professionals and families, characterised by Victorian terraces, modern development, and vibrant local amenities.
